BIO

Chamirai Charles Nyabeze is the Vice President of Business Development at the Centre for Excellence in Mining Innovation (CEMI) and the Network Director of the Mining Innovation Commercialization Accelerator (MICA), where he leads national efforts to accelerate the commercialization of cutting-edge mining technologies.

With a background in Mining Engineering and an MBA, Charles has over 20 years of experience driving innovation, ecosystem development, and strategic partnerships across Canada and internationally.

He has played a pivotal role in mobilizing over $640 million in innovation funding, supporting more than 50 advanced mining projects, and growing MICA’s membership to over 100 stakeholders, including major mining companies and SMEs.

As the Founder and CEO of NOBEEP, he also champions inclusive economic development for Black entrepreneurs in Northern Ontario.

Fluent in Shona and currently learning French, Charles is a passionate advocate for aligning mining innovation with community impact, national priorities, and global opportunity.

The Canadian Mining Innovation Ecosystem

Chamirai Charles Nyabeze will deliver a compelling overview of Canada’s mining innovation ecosystem, focusing on how the MICA Network—under the leadership of CEMI—is accelerating the commercialization of breakthrough technologies across the entire mining cycle. His presentation will spotlight transformative solutions currently funded through MICA that address critical industry priorities including increased productivity, energy efficiency, smart autonomous systems, and environmental risk reduction. He will also explore how innovation in areas such as circularity, critical minerals, ESG, and digitalization are helping Canada secure its position as a global leader in mining. Drawing from real examples, Chamirai will illustrate how these innovations are creating safer, smarter, and more sustainable mines, while supporting local supply chains, community engagement, and long-term economic resilience.
